The ADM706SAN operates by continuously monitoring the supply voltage. When the voltage falls below the specified threshold, the reset output is asserted, indicating a system reset. The reset remains active until the voltage rises above the threshold or a manual reset signal is applied. The adjustable reset timeout period allows customization based on specific application requirements.
